简介:本文将详细介绍如何在外部应用程序中连接到阿里云数据库,以及相关的设置和注意事项。
在今天的数字化时代,数据已经成为一种宝贵的资产。对于企业来说,一个稳定、可靠的数据存储平台至关重要。阿里云数据库作为一种强大的云计算服务,为企业提供了便捷的数据存储和管理方式。本文将重点介绍如何在外部应用程序中连接到阿里云数据库。
首先,我们需要创建一个新的阿里云数据库实例。在阿里云控制台中,选择“数据库”服务,然后点击“购买实例”。在实例类型中,我们可以选择适合自己的存储量和性能需求。接下来,我们需要设置数据库的网络访问方式。对于内部应用,可以选择VPC网络访问方式,这样可以确保数据的安全性和访问速度。对于外部应用,可以选择Internet访问方式。
在设置完成后,我们需要获取数据库的连接信息。在数据库的详情页面,我们可以找到"管理"选项,点击进入。在"管理"页面中,我们可以看到数据库的主机名、端口号和数据库名称。这些信息是我们连接数据库的关键。
下面,我们来看一下如何在外部应用程序中连接到阿里云数据库。假设我们的外部应用程序是一个Java程序,我们可以使用JDBC来连接数据库。以下是一个简单的示例:
```java import java.sql.*;
public class Main { public static void main(String[] args) { String url ="jdbc:mysql://[主机名]:[端口号]/[数据库名]"; String user = "[用户名]"; String password ="[密码]";
Connection conn = DriverManager.getConnection(url, user, password); System.out.println("连接成功!");}
} ```
在上述代码中,我们使用
DriverManager.getConnection()
方法连接到数据库。需要替换
[主机名]
、
[端口号]
和
[数据库名]
为实际的数据库信息。
在连接成功后,我们可以执行SQL查询、插入、更新和删除操作。下面是一个简单的查询示例:
java String sql = "SELECT * FROM [表名]"; Statement stmt =conn.createStatement(); ResultSet rs = stmt.executeQuery(sql); while(rs.next()) { int id = rs.getInt("id"); String name = rs.getString("name");System.out.println("ID: " + id + ", Name: " + name); }
在上述代码中,我们执行了一个基本的SQL查询。需要注意的是,在连接数据库时,我们需要确保数据库已经启动并且能够接受连接。
除了JDBC,我们还可以使用其他编程语言如Python、PHP、Node.js等来连接数据库。只需要将上述代码中的Java代码替换为对应语言的语法即可。
在使用阿里云数据库的过程中,还有一些需要注意的问题。首先,为了保证数据的安全性,我们需要对数据库进行权限控制,只授权特定用户或角色访问数据库。其次,我们需要定期备份数据库,以防数据丢失。最后,我们需要监控数据库的运行状态,及时发现并解决问题。
总的来说,阿里云数据库是一个强大且灵活的数据存储工具。通过正确的设置和使用,我们可以方便地在外部应用程序中连接到阿里云数据库,并进行有效的数据操作。
评论